Top definition
A word used to tell someone that you were basically doing absolutely nothing; A slang synonym of masterbation;
A word used to describe the climax of a sexual encounter.
What did you do last night? Stayed home and chuched!
Boss, you chuchin over there?
She came over to my place and I chuched all over her!
Where are you going? To the store to buy some chuch-paper
by iamcandien December 16, 2011
Get the mug
Get a Chuchin mug for your guy Nathalie.

Available Domains :D